Plant Replacement in Honolulu, HI

Plant replacement services involve removing existing plants, such as trees, shrubs, or flowers, and installing new greenery to enhance the appearance and health of outdoor spaces. These projects often include replacing dead or overgrown plants, updating landscaping designs, or refreshing garden beds to improve curb appeal. Homeowners typically seek this service when plants have become unhealthy, damaged, or no longer suit the landscape, as well as when they want to update their property's aesthetic with new plantings.

Before requesting plant replacement, property owners usually want to understand the types of plants that thrive in their specific environment, including factors like soil, sunlight, and water needs. It’s also helpful to consider the size and placement of new plants to ensure they complement existing features and do not interfere with structures or utilities. Clarifying these details can support a smooth process and ensure the new plantings meet the desired landscape goals.

Plant Replacement Questions

When should a plant be replaced? Replacement is recommended when a plant shows signs of decline, disease, or no longer fits the landscape design.

What types of plants are suitable for replacement? Hardy, native, or climate-appropriate plants are often chosen to ensure long-term health and visual appeal.

How does plant replacement impact existing landscaping? Proper replacement can enhance the overall appearance and health of the landscape without disrupting other features.

What should property owners consider before replacing a plant? Consider the plant’s growth habits, location, and how it complements the surrounding landscape to ensure a successful replacement.
